In its recently released report –"Rail Reform: A Guided Mind" – the All-Party Parliamentary Rail Group reviewed alternative structures for passengers and freight operators with the objective of improving the flow of traffic, competition, customer service and creating new markets.

The All-Party Parliamentary Rail Group – chaired by Martin Vickers MP - delivered its report to the Rail Minister, Chris Heaton-Harris MP for consideration alongside the conclusions of the Williams Review. 

The inquiry took place in June and July 2019, with contributions from Arriva Trains UK, FirstGroup, Jonathan Tyler, the Office for Rail and Road, Network Rail, the Rail Delivery Group, the Rail Freight Group and the Urban Transport Group. Burges Salmon assisted the APPRG with clerking the evidence sessions and drafting the Report.
